Output 54d90145f18d137e12c092c5b0207aa7a6920dc6e2ddc1e6caa31cf0e094ba84:2

value
6626000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10123bf1955e68cf6c1c62888d3d8a0aaaa606d6 OP_EQUAL
address
339zaYXRMPQeQbAoA416J1koBn7eYcMLpL
transaction
54d90145f18d137e12c092c5b0207aa7a6920dc6e2ddc1e6caa31cf0e094ba84
spent
true